    AVERAGE SPEED

    Jeremy Lin: 16.66 mph

    Derrick Rose: 16.60 mph

    John Wall: 16.48 mph

    Kyrie Irving: 15.67 mph

    Lin wins this battle.

    START SPEED

    Lin: 13.93 mph

    Wall: 13.25 mph

    Irving: 12.64 mph

    For Rose, BAM has only average speed data.

    Lin wins this battle too.

    TOP SPEED

    Lin: 18.85 mph

    Wall: 19.30 mph

    Irving: 18.74 mph

    Have you watched him play. he dribbles the ball up. Looks for the open man, runs PnR for Chandler or Amare, looks for Melo, pulls up and shoots or drives the lane and shoots if open or passes to the open guy. It's pretty standard stuff that gets him assists and points. If all that is not available he runs a play.

    He has a better midrange game than Lowry, shoots the midrange shot better and passes better. he could easily do the same thing here or pretty much anywhere. Jeremy Lin is legit although he is being overhyped right now. It's like the say you're never as bad as you feel when you are on the bottom or as good as when you are top. Lin is a very solid player much better than Johnny Flynn but no Steve nash.
